Output 2e0e4bdecd557af03c2709d4e9a5e9a2dfc06e94bdd6bd2328b32070e1577e28:21

value
689159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8142faac60da2d252b837c359fd2532c1bce64c OP_EQUAL
address
3QJjggMrpUVWN1MkkT2wbKkHZaLpE1JWtw
transaction
2e0e4bdecd557af03c2709d4e9a5e9a2dfc06e94bdd6bd2328b32070e1577e28
spent
true